Co to jest i jak działa job scheduler w bazie danych? Tworzenie joba sql z dbms_scheduler.

  Рет қаралды 3,638

nieinformatyk

nieinformatyk

Күн бұрын

✅Co to jest scheduler job w bazie danych? To program, który wykonuje się automatycznie zgodnie ze zdefiniowanym przez nas harmonogramem. Z nagrania dowiesz się jak używać pakietu PL/SQL dbms_scheduler by taki program stworzyć. Opowiem Ci też o tym kiedy z jobów korzystać i na jakie detale zwracać uwagę. Zapraszam do oglądania.
🎁 ODBIERZ PREZENT - promo.plsql.pl/
== 🔗 Przydatne linki z nagrania:==
🏷️zapisy na kurs PL/SQL: nieinformatyk.pl/kurs/1760/pr...
🏷️lista oczekujących na kurs PL/SQL: nieinformatyk.pl/strona/plsql...
🏷️dokumentacja dbms_scheduler: docs.oracle.com/en/database/o...
🏷️odcinek o funkcjach PL/SQL: • Jak tworzyć funkcję w ...
🏷️odcinek o procedurach PL/SQL: • Co to jest procedura P...
🏷️odcinek o triggerze PL/SQL: • Kurs PLSQL3: Co to jes...
🏷️odcinek o pakietach PL/SQL: • Create Package in Orac...
🏷️odcinek o słownikach: • Słowniki w bazie danyc...
== 👌 Polecam obejrzeć:==
Co to jest i jak stworzyć wyzwalacz: • Kurs PLSQL3: Co to jes...
Do czego służy widok w bazie danych: • Czym są widoki w sql? #64
== ⏱️ Plan odcinka:==
00:00 start
00:30 wprowadzenie od odcinka
01:40 wyzwalacz vs job
03:16 tworzenie joba
07:48 nadanie uprawnień do dbms_scheduler i create job
08:55 usuwanie joba
09:08 inny sposób tworzenia jobów
09:50 tworzenie i usuwanie programu joba
11:31 tworzenie i usuwanie harmonogramu joba
12:35 tworzenie joba korzystającego z programu i harmonogramu
13:32 słowniki przydatne do pracy z jobami
17:17 podsumowanie odcinka
#bazodanowiec
== 👨‍💻 Poznaj mniej lepiej:==
* Moja strona: www.nieinformatyk.pl/
* Kod z odcinka: www.nieinformatyk.pl/pliki
* Facebook: / nieinformatyk
* Linkedin: / darekbutkiewicz
* Instagram: / nieinformatyk
* Twitter: / nieinformatyk
Zasubskrybuj mój kanał: kzfaq.info...
🏁 Witaj na moim kanale :)
Jestem programistą baz danych Oracle oraz developerem hurtownii danych (ETL). W tym miejscu dzielę się z oglądającymi wiedzą dotyczącą relacyjnych baz danych, praktycznych technik pisania SQL oraz optymalizacji kodu PL/SQL. Jeśli chcesz zdobyć praktyczną i rzetelną więdzę o bazach danych to trafiłeś na właściwe miejsce.
🚨 Więcej informacji o bazach danych znajdziesz zupełnie ZA DARMO na www.nieinformatyk.pl i nieinformatyk.pl/strona/plsql...
📧 Masz pytanie, prośbę, sugestię? Pisz śmiało na kontakt@nieinformatyk.pl

Пікірлер: 30
@fatallny
@fatallny 2 жыл бұрын
Cześć Darku, wszyscy czekamy na nowy materiał :)
@nieinformatyk
@nieinformatyk 2 жыл бұрын
Już wracam do nagrywania, kurs PL/SQL zajął mnie na dłużej niż się spodziewałem :)
@ZenonMcRae
@ZenonMcRae 2 жыл бұрын
Dla zasięgu!
@nieinformatyk
@nieinformatyk 2 жыл бұрын
dzięki :)
@exztaza
@exztaza Жыл бұрын
będzie coś jeszcze z serii plsql? czy reszta materiałów dla kursantów?
@nieinformatyk
@nieinformatyk Жыл бұрын
pewnie jeszcze nie jeden odcinek wrzucę do tej serii :) nie wiem tylko kiedy, bo większe ciśnienie mam by dzielić się wiedzą, której jeszcze nie ułożyłem w postaci kursu. W kursie PL/SQL jest 25 godzin nagrań, więc chętni nauki PL/SQL mają już kompletne źródło :)
@llkk2559
@llkk2559 Жыл бұрын
Cześć. Czy mogę jako job_action sformułować tworzenie widoku bazodanowego? Albo może podpowiesz mi czego użyć aby stworzyć coś takiego jak automatyczne tworzenie widoku za pomocą vteate view raz w miesiącu?
@nieinformatyk
@nieinformatyk Жыл бұрын
musisz użyć dynamicznego SQL. Poczytaj o EXECUTE IMMEDIATE
@tomnap2328
@tomnap2328 6 ай бұрын
Cześć. Dlaczego job po zmianie czasu zimowy/letni (albo odwrotnie) wykonuje się godzinę wcześniej/później?
@nieinformatyk
@nieinformatyk 6 ай бұрын
Job się wykonuje zgodnie z ustawieniem zegara na serwerze bazodanowym. Sprawdź jaka jest tam godzina :)
@tomnap2328
@tomnap2328 2 жыл бұрын
Cześć. O co chodzi z DBMS_JOB? Job z Twojego kodu tworzy się w JOB, a ja na bazie mam jeszcze joby w DBMS_JOB. Jaka jest różnica między nimi?
@nieinformatyk
@nieinformatyk 2 жыл бұрын
DBMS_JOB to podobnie jak DBMS_SCHEDULER pakiet PL/SQL do tworzenia jobów. DBM_SCHEDULER to nowszy i bardziej rozbudowany pakiet, więc DBMS_JOB-em nie musisz sobie zawracać głowy. O pakietach mówiłem tutaj: kzfaq.info/get/bejne/qp55gtd4sdOYeo0.html
@tomnap2328
@tomnap2328 2 жыл бұрын
​@@nieinformatyk O DBMS_JOB muszą zgłębić wiedzę, bo też zacząłem pracę jako programista i coś się wysypało właśnie w tym jobie i mam to naprawić. Dzięki za kanał, dużo pomógł w nauce.
@krzysztofxd2760
@krzysztofxd2760 2 жыл бұрын
Czy ciężko jest znaleźć prace jako początkujący programista czy to prawda ,ze 90% firm nie przyjmuje ludzi bez wykształcenia wyższego na stanowisko programista?
@nieinformatyk
@nieinformatyk 2 жыл бұрын
Nie słyszałem o takiej statystyce. Jeśli dopiero zaczynasz to postąpiłbym w ten sposób: kzfaq.info/get/bejne/h7V1Y7iZxNe6c2g.html
@krzysztofxd2760
@krzysztofxd2760 2 жыл бұрын
@@nieinformatyk Czy to prawda, ze przyjmują jedynie na programistów ludzi po technikum informatycznym lub po studiach? Z tego co wiem ty masz wykształcenie informatyczne czy pracodawcy brali je pod uwagę podczas twoich poszukiwań pracy w IT? (Czy mogę wiedzieć na jakim stanowisku pracujesz i ile zarabiasz) Czy programista 15k to mit czy rzeczywistość?
@nieinformatyk
@nieinformatyk 2 жыл бұрын
@@krzysztofxd2760 Nie, to nie prawda. Sam nie mam wykształcenia informatycznego. Jeśli ktoś brał pod uwagę dyplom to chyba tylko podczas decyzji kogo zaprosić na rozmowę. Na samej rozmowie nikt się nie odnosił do moich studiów, a pytał o doświadczenie i umiejętności. Obejrzyj nagranie, które Ci wysłałem w poprzedniej odpowiedzi - mówiłem, ile "mniej więcej zarabiam". Pracuję jako ETL Developer a programista 15k to nie mit.
@krzysztofxd2760
@krzysztofxd2760 2 жыл бұрын
@@nieinformatyk Czy jak w ogłoszeniu jest napisane wymagane wykształcenie wyższe techniczne to znaczy, ze jak go nie posiadam to nie ma sensu tam aplikować? " Czy to może jedynie kandydat idealny i mimo wszystko warto wysłać tam CV?
@nieinformatyk
@nieinformatyk 2 жыл бұрын
@@krzysztofxd2760 Ja aplikując na takie ogłoszenie dostałem pierwszą pracę. Wymagali 2 lat a dostałem pracę, bo miałem niskie oczekiwania finansowe :)
@zbigniewwozniak6172
@zbigniewwozniak6172 9 ай бұрын
Zachęcam do używania polszczyzny. W języku polskim nie istnieje określenie job scheduler tylko planista pracy. Czy naprawdę Polacy zapomnieli już własnego języka i jak te bezmyślne baranki bełkoczą niby po angielsku, a w rzeczywistości kaleczą również ten język? Tylko proszę mi nie wyjeżdżać z morałami, że język polski ewoluuje. Pozdrawiam z Wielkiej Brytanii.
@nieinformatyk
@nieinformatyk 8 ай бұрын
Chciałbym zobaczyć rozmowę o pracę lub spotkanie z zespołem bazodanowców, gdy ktoś stwierdza, że "planista pracy nie działa prawidłowo" :) Pewne terminy w IT mają swoje konkretne znaczenie i używania się ich nie dlatego, że ktoś nie chce używać polskiego, tylko dlatego, że jest tak dużo prościej, bo każdy je rozumie, np. daily, stored procedure czy no_data_found.
@zbigniewwozniak6172
@zbigniewwozniak6172 8 ай бұрын
@@nieinformatyk Masz wyraźnie kompleksy. Wstydzisz się, że polski język nie brzmi cool? Co znaczy cool po polsku? Dałeś zwieść się prowokacji. Branża IT i technologie używają języka międzynarodowej komunikacji, czyli angielskiego. Ale... Na co dzień w mowie potocznej Polacy zalewają rodzimy język zastępując polskie słowa angielskimi, dzięki czemu powstaje bełkot ulicy. Największa żenada jest słyszeć cyt. Wylała się fala hejtu i nienawiści. Pozdrawiam i życzę sukcesów w IT oraz poprawnej polszczyzny poza branżą.
@nieinformatyk
@nieinformatyk 8 ай бұрын
​@@zbigniewwozniak6172 Rozbawiłeś mnie swoim komentarzem, serio :) tu nie chodzi o wstyd czy kompleksy, ale czysty pragmatyzm i wygodę. Komunikacja w IT używając słów zapożyczonych z angielskiego jest dużo sprawniejsza i to główna przyczyna dlaczego większość osób(w tym ja) się adaptuje do tych zasad. Reszta to Twoje kompletnie nietrafione domysły. Jestem w stanie zrozumieć, że pursytom językowym to przeszkadza, ale czy taki trend jest dobry czy zły to się nie wypowiem, bo "it's not my cup of tea". Pozdrawiam i życzę więcej dystansu do życia.
@zbigniewwozniak6172
@zbigniewwozniak6172 8 ай бұрын
@@nieinformatyk Czytaj uważnie mój drugi komentarz.
Dlaczego indeks przyśpiesza wykonywanie zapytań SQL?
17:48
nieinformatyk
Рет қаралды 4,1 М.
Poziomy izolacji sql - wyjaśnienie dla laika + przykłady
27:36
nieinformatyk
Рет қаралды 3,7 М.
УГАДАЙ ГДЕ ПРАВИЛЬНЫЙ ЦВЕТ?😱
00:14
МЯТНАЯ ФАНТА
Рет қаралды 3,9 МЛН
Mom's Unique Approach to Teaching Kids Hygiene #shorts
00:16
Fabiosa Stories
Рет қаралды 28 МЛН
Became invisible for one day!  #funny #wednesday #memes
00:25
Watch Me
Рет қаралды 60 МЛН
Heartwarming Unity at School Event #shorts
00:19
Fabiosa Stories
Рет қаралды 20 МЛН
Rodzaje indeksów w bazie danych Oracle
19:58
nieinformatyk
Рет қаралды 3,3 М.
Co to jest relacyjna baza danych? Model relacyjny danych od podstaw
16:11
Kubernetes Crash Course for Absolute Beginners [NEW]
1:12:04
TechWorld with Nana
Рет қаралды 2,6 МЛН
Podstawy baz danych SQL, które musisz znać
13:44
nieinformatyk
Рет қаралды 9 М.
Co to jest skrypt sql? Tworzenie skryptów baz danych od podstaw
22:21
Телефон-електрошокер
0:43
RICARDO 2.0
Рет қаралды 1,3 МЛН
$1 vs $100,000 Slow Motion Camera!
0:44
Hafu Go
Рет қаралды 27 МЛН
КРУТОЙ ТЕЛЕФОН
0:16
KINO KAIF
Рет қаралды 6 МЛН
Новые iPhone 16 и 16 Pro Max
0:42
Romancev768
Рет қаралды 757 М.
Худшие кожаные чехлы для iPhone
1:00
Rozetked
Рет қаралды 1,6 МЛН